About Thomas swirl bread

Thomas Swirl Bread is a flavorful, pre-sliced bread popular in North America, known for its soft texture and sweet, rich taste. It typically features a delicious swirl of cinnamon, raisin, or other sweet fillings baked directly into the slices. Made from enriched wheat flour, it contains essential vitamins and minerals such as iron and folic acid, often added during the flour enrichment process. While it offers a convenient source of carbohydrates and fiber, this bread does contain added sugars, making it less suitable for low-sugar diets. However, its low fat content can make it a lighter option compared to pastries and other breakfast treats. Thomas Swirl Bread pairs well with spreads or fruit and is versatile for quick breakfasts or snacks. Its origins are inspired by traditional cinnamon raisin breads, adapted for modern convenience and American tastes.
